高校教务管理系统(高校教务管理系统数据库设计)
高校教务管理系统与数据库设计概述
在高等教育领域,教务管理系统作为学校日常运营的重要支撑系统,扮演着不可替代的角色,无论是学生课程管理、考试安排,还是教职工的人力资源管理,教务系统都为高校提供了高效、便捷的解决方案,教务管理系统的数据库设计是整个系统的核心部分,直接关系到系统的性能、安全性以及用户体验。
高校教务管理系统概述
高校教务管理系统是一款专为高校设计的综合管理信息系统,通常包括学生管理、课程安排、考试管理、成绩查询、教职工管理等多个模块,通过代入学校的实际需求,教务系统能够实现资源的高效配置和信息的精准管理,极大地提升了学校的管理效率。
随着信息技术的不断进步,现代教务系统不仅仅局限于纸质化操作,而是通过信息化手段实现了各类业务的在线化、智能化,学生和教职工可以通过系统进行业务办理,学校管理层也能实时掌握各项运营数据,为决策提供支持。

高校教务管理系统数据库设计
作为教务系统的核心,数据库设计需要综合考虑数据的存储、检索、安全性以及系统的扩展性,数据库设计的关键点包括:
数据需求分析
在设计数据库之前,需要明确系统中需要处理哪些数据类型,以及这些数据之间的关系,学生信息、课程信息、成绩信息等,需要以表格的形式存储,并确保数据的一致性和完整性。数据库结构设计
数据库通常采用关系型数据库设计,通过主键-外键关系建立数据之间的联系,学生表、课程表、成绩表之间通过学生ID、课程ID等字段建立关联,这种设计不仅便于数据的管理,还能保证数据的一致性。数据安全与隐私保护
在设计数据库时,必须考虑数据安全问题,学生的个人信息、考试成绩等敏感数据需要通过加密方式存储,防止数据泄露,权限管理也是数据库设计的重要部分,确保只有授权人员才能访问特定的数据。系统的扩展性
数据库设计还需要考虑系统的扩展性,未来是否会新增课程、增加学生规模等,数据库设计应预留扩展空间,避免因为数据量过大或业务需求增加而需要重新设计数据库。
数据库设计的注意事项
在实际操作中,数据库设计还需要注意以下几点:
规范化设计
数据库表、字段、关系等需要按照一定的规范进行设计,避免数据冗余和冗余关系,使用标准的字段命名规范、表名规范等,确保数据库的易维护性。选择合适的数据库管理系统
根据学校的实际需求,选择适合的数据库管理系统,MySQL、Oracle、Microsoft SQL Server等都是常用的数据库管理系统,选择时需要综合考虑系统的性能、安全性以及维护成本。优化数据库性能
数据库性能直接影响到系统的运行效率,通过优化索引结构、减少冗余数据、优化查询语句等方式,可以显著提升数据库的查询速度和处理能力。数据备份与恢复
数据库的数据安全性不仅依赖于加密技术,还需要建立数据备份与恢复机制,以防止数据丢失,定期备份数据库,确保重要数据的安全。
案例分析:高校教务系统的实际应用
在实际应用中,高校教务系统的数据库设计需要结合学校的具体需求,云南水利水电职业学院、首钢工学院、北京农业职业学院等高校的教务系统,其数据库设计都有着独特的特点。
云南水利水电职业学院教务系统
该学院作为全省唯一一所水利水电类高职学校,其教务系统的数据库设计需要突出水利水电专业特点,课程设置更多倾向于水利水电相关课程,学生信息中可能设置专业特有的字段。首钢工学院教务系统
首钢工学院是一所工科高等院校,其教务系统的数据库设计需要考虑工科专业的特点,课程设置更多涉及冶金、机电等工科专业,学生信息中可能设置专业特有的科目代码。北京农业职业学院教务系统
该学院是全国高职高专人才培养工作水平评估优秀院校,其教务系统的数据库设计需要考虑高职教育的特点,课程设置涵盖广泛,学生信息管理需要支持大规模的学生数据处理。
总结与展望
高校教务管理系统的数据库设计是一个复杂而重要的任务,需要综合考虑数据管理、系统性能、安全性等多方面的因素,在实际应用中,数据库设计还需要结合学校的具体需求,确保系统的高效运行和数据的安全性。
随着信息技术的不断发展,未来的教务系统将更加智能化和个性化,人工智能技术可以用于智能化的课题安排,区分学生的学习习惯和特点,提供更加精准的学习建议,大数据分析技术可以帮助学校更好地了解学生的学习情况,为教育决策提供数据支持。
未来的数据库设计也将更加注重实用性和灵活性,通过微服务架构、云计算技术等方式,实现数据库的高效管理和快速扩展,希望通过本文的介绍,对高校教务管理系统和数据库设计有所帮助,助力高校教育事业的发展。
如果你对这方面的信息感兴趣,记得收藏关注本站,以获取更多实用的资源和信息!
文章已关闭评论!










